I am 11 weeks 1 day today and will hopefully be joining you all soon on this board (fingers are crossed). I was wondering if any of you had bleeds during your first trimester due to a sensitive cervix?
I have had about 5 isolated bleeds during this first trimester. Of course, each time I freak out and expexct the worst. After two particularly scary ones I had ultrasounds done to make sure everything was okay and both times the baby was doing great (growth was normal and heartbeat was strong).
Having had a miscarriage before I am getting a little tired of these scares. I have to use progesterone cream vaginally and my doctor thinks that I am somehow irritating my cervix sometimes when I insert the cream, causing a bleed due to irritation or a popped blood vessel.
I was wondering if anyone had anything similar occur? Usually the bleeds last for about 1-2 minutes then are gone. They are not accompanied by cramps at all and are completely random. The blood is red but stops and then I have no follow-up spotting at all. This seems to happen about once every two weeks or so, sometimes only a week in between.
Needless to say I am anxious to get to a "safer" zone and am so anxious for the second trimester. I have my first trimester screen next week on Wednesday and am hoping to feel encouraged by that.
Any similar stories out there of oversensitive cervix?

It is totally scary. I had one ultrasound 1st tri for bleeding and I was freaking out! It was a tiny amount of blood, though, similar to what you described, and it was fine. My OB always asks if it's enough to soak a pad. If it's not, you're probably fine. I know it's totally freaky, and I'd continue to keep your doc posted on what's happening, but try not to stress.
Also, you didn't mention it, but if you're having any sex that can definitely do it. I went to labor and delivery last week for what looked like a massacre post-sex (blood was EVERYWHERE and way more than I had the first time I got checked out for bleeding). Baby was doing great, no contractions or anything, cervix totally closed, and she tested me for infection and that came back negative, too. Welcome to the super-sensitive-cervix club!
